Answer (c):

Payback period:

Merits of Payback method:

1. It is simple to calculate

2. Its principle of evaluating projects based on how quickly one can recover initial investment works well for risky investments or investments in technology investments where obsolescence rate is high.  

Demerits of Payback method:

1. It does not consider time value of money

2. It does not consider cash flows after payback period.

NPV:

Merits of NPV:

1. NPV provides net addition to shareholder value.

2. NPV uses time value of money

3. It factors in cash flows of entire duration of project

Demerits of NPV:

1. When capital is limited and projects have to be ranked for selection, it is essential that initial capital investments are factored in. In such circumstances, instead of NPV, Profitability Index has to be used.

IRR:

Merits of IRR:

1. IRR gives % return on the original money invested.

2. IRR uses time value of money

3. It factors in cash flows of entire duration of project

Demerits of IRR:

1. In quite a few circumstances when cash flows are erratic one may find multiple IRRs of an investment.

2. IRR assumes reinvestment at the rate of IRR
